Tarnmoor's depot network covers all three of our regional hubs, including the Aldervale facility, and their service-level guarantees exceed Hallowick's current performance by a measurable margin. Transition costs are estimated within the approved contingency, and Marta Quillen's team has prepared a phased handover plan to avoid disruption. The strategic context for this change is summarised in the confidential note below.

board note of bawep-tajef: Queniusek Systems plans to raise the Quenvan list price by 53.1 percent in March. The pricing group signed off on a budget of $176.4 million for Project Drueth. The renewal with Casionix Partners closes at $142.5 million a year, 8.3 percent below the last contract. Project Fraax slips by six weeks because of the tooling delay.

// Heads up, reviewer: this client pulls the live occupancy feed from
// GarageGlance, our internal service that aggregates stall counts across
// the Northvale and Pellerton decks. Polling is every 20s — any faster
// and the feed starts returning stale snapshots, ask me how I know.
// Auth is the usual header token, loaded from config below.

app token of kafop-hahaf = kto11_iRLdsMBafGn

14:22 — Grindle config hot-reload pushed a malformed rate-limit block; watcher applied it without validation. API pods began rejecting all traffic within 90 seconds. On-call reverted via the last-known-good snapshot at 14:31. Validation gate added to the reload path; do not bypass it. The offending reload is traceable via the token below.

session token of tajef-bageg = htk21_5d90d574934f3ccae6437

**Q: How do I recover the Brontide build cache after the hermetic migration?**

During the move to the Hermeticore toolchain, the legacy cache on the Quellfarm cluster was sealed. If a rebuild stalls mid-migration, do not purge the sandbox; instead, unseal the cache vault from the migration console and replay the last good snapshot. Unsealing requires the migration recovery passphrase, which is recorded directly below this entry.

recovery phrase for bajog-kadug: lamion-novdor-oliix-belox-nordor-praeth-sorael